Microsoft will end support for Windows Server 2016 on January 12, 2027, after which the operating system will no longer receive security updates, bug fixes, or technical support. Systems that remain on Windows Server 2016 after this date may be exposed to security risks and may fall out of compliance with Dartmouth’s Information Security Policy, so system owners should begin planning to migrate, replace, or decommission these servers.

You do not need access to the LISTSERV Admin Web UI to manage your list.
As a list owner, you can perform all essential administration and moderation tasks
directly by email. The web interface is just a convenience layer – the underlying
controls are all email-based.
